[0019] see figure 1 and figure 2 , figure 1 is a functional block diagram of a navigation device 10 with a noise detection function according to an embodiment of the present invention, figure 2 It is a partial structural diagram of the navigation device 10 according to the embodiment of the present invention. The navigation device 10 includes a light emitting unit 12 , an image capturing unit 14 and a processing unit 16 . The processing unit 16 is electrically connected to the light emitting unit 12 and the image capturing unit 14 . The processing unit 16 can change the reference light intensity by controlling the adjustable shutter 18 and / or the adjustable aperture 20 of the light emitting unit 12 , so that the image capturing unit 14 can obtain an image with sufficient brightness. Abstract

The invention discloses an image processing method used to detect noise. The method comprises: adjusting an illuminating unit to obtain an overexposure image, comparing each pixel of the overexposure image with at least a threshold value, when the luminance of one pixel of the overexposure image is lower than the threshold value, marking the pixel as a noise point, and eliminating the noise point, and executing displacement detection operation. The invention also discloses a navigation device with a noise detecting function.

technical field [0001] The present invention provides an image processing method and its navigation device, especially an image processing method which can be used to detect noise, and its navigation device with noise detection function. Background technique [0002] In a traditional optical mouse, an optical transmitter, an optical receiver, and an operation processor are arranged in a casing. When the optical mouse moves, the light emitted by the light emitter is reflected by the desktop or the mouse pad and received by the light receiver. The calculation processor analyzes the reflected light to interpret the surface structure characteristics of the desktop or mouse pad, and uses these surface structure features in the light. The position change within the field of view of the receiver is used to calculate the displacement of the optical mouse.
